Chemicals are defined as single elements or combinations of elements bonded to one another. Elements are the basic building blocks of matter. All known elements can be found on the periodic table, which organizes them according to their properties and behavior.

Chemicals are essential building blocks for everything in the world. All living matter, including people, animals and plants, consists of chemicals. All food is made up of global chemical substances. Chemicals in food are largely harmless and often desirable – for example, nutrients such as carbohydrates , protein , fat and fibre are composed of global chemical compounds. Many of these occur naturally and contribute both to a rounded diet and to our eating experience.

Chemicals can, however, have a variety of toxicological properties, some of which might cause effects in humans and animals. Usually, these are not harmful unless we are exposed to them for a long time and at high levels. Scientists help to safeguard against these harmful effects by establishing safe levels. This scientific advice informs decision-makers who regulate the use of global chemical in food or seek to limit their presence in the food chain.
Food packaging materials and containers such as bottles, cups and plates, used to improve food handling and transport, can contain global chemical substances such as plastic, elements of which can migrate into food. Other chemicals can be used to fight diseases in farm animals or crops, or can sometimes be found in food as a result of a production process such as heating/cooking or decontamination treatment.

Some plants and fungi naturally produce toxins that can contaminate crops and be a concern for human and animal health. People can also be exposed to both naturally occurring and man-made global chemical compounds present at various levels in the environment, e.g. in soil, water and the atmosphere. Examples include industrial pollutants such as dioxins and PCBs. A variety of metals can be present naturally in the environment or as a result of human activity.
Sometimes traces of global chemical are unintentionally present in food because of food production and preparation methods, such as residues of pesticides or additives used in animal feed. Small traces of chemicals from packaging and other food contact materials can also unintentionally end up in food.
